SamenvattingPublished in conjunction with the first in a series of exhibitions organized to reflect the American Craft Museum's examination of the increasingly important points of creative intersection between craft and related fields. The 335 color and b&w illustrations of interior objects such as cookware, serving pieces, furnishings, accessories, and objects used for sports, music, and play show how craftspeople view the creation of functional objects as a way to express artistic and cultural values. Two essays by editor Paul J. Smith (director of the American Craft Museum) and Akiko Busch (contributing editor at Metropolis magazine) focus on the role of craft and design in contemporary life. The volume also contains profiles of 25 artists and shorter biographies of all of the nearly 200 craftspeople represented. Oversize: 10x12<">. Annotation c.
